Kailani Kahale was born to save the earth from annihilation, her grandfather's mysterious vision foretelling her fate—at least that's what her family says. But how can she believe them when they're nothing but killers, liars, and cowards?

Just in case, she lives off the grid on her property in the Hawaiian jungle, quietly tending to her bees, avoiding contact with the outside world.

Everything changes when the FBI finds a body on her land, forcing her into hiding. To return home, she must confront the devil, a Texas lawyer named David Goddard; uncover the web of family lies; and find her true purpose. She just has to do it before the planet blows to bits.

I'm Mary Jung

I am an author, an audiobook narrator, and a podcast producer, which means I'm living my dream life. In the before times, I went job to job, profession to profession, from industry analyst to blackjack dealer to sales to software engineer. I also have a graduate degree for library science but was never able to secure a position as a librarian, possibly because I’m too loud.

Currently residing near Seattle, I've lived everywhere from the mountains to the desert and of course the Pacific Ocean, notably the Big Island of Hawai’i. While I was there, I promised the volcano goddess Pele I would write a story about her land. It was only after I finished Killers, Liars, and Cowards: A Portrait of a Family that I realized the story of that land is the story of all lands.
